File 0014-ppp-ip-up-fixed-netconfig-modify-calls.patch of Package sysconfig.openSUSE_13.1_Update
From 150a2c9eb8a85152961c591b73e10ef61e24bd8d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Marius Tomaschewski <mt@suse.com> Date: Wed, 9 Apr 2014 09:56:16 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] ppp/ip-up: fixed netconfig modify calls The global config file now explicitly sets the NETCONFIG_VERBOSE variable to yes/no, what breaks the netconfig call from ip-up using it to pass a "-v" as a command line option (bnc#872689). --- scripts/ip-up | 4 ++-- 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-) diff --git a/scripts/ip-up b/scripts/ip-up index b09430e..4cb6aa6 100755 --- a/scripts/ip-up +++ b/scripts/ip-up @@ -76,7 +76,7 @@ add_nameservers() fi echo "NETBIOSNAMESERVER='${winsservers[@]}'" #fi - } | /sbin/netconfig modify -s pppd -i "$INTERFACE" $NETCONFIG_VERBOSE + } | /sbin/netconfig modify -s pppd -i "$INTERFACE" } restore_nameservers() { @@ -90,7 +90,7 @@ restore_nameservers() `) test -z "$noremove" || return fi - /sbin/netconfig remove -s pppd -i "$INTERFACE" $NETCONFIG_VERBOSE + /sbin/netconfig remove -s pppd -i "$INTERFACE" } # using this function currently breaks Dial On Demand setups, because -- 1.8.4.5
